#f6b00e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6b00e is composed of 96.5% red, 69%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.5%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 41.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 51%. #f6b00e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1c with #ed6100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

#f6b00e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6b00e has RGB values of R:246, G:176,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.94,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16166926.

Shades and Tints of #f6b00e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050300 is the darkest color, while #fefaf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6b00e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838281 is the less saturated color, while #f6b00e is the most saturated one.
